技术文摘
Idea 中利用正则表达式批量替换字符串的办法
Idea 中利用正则表达式批量替换字符串的办法
在软件开发过程中,经常会遇到需要批量替换字符串的情况。而 IntelliJ IDEA 作为一款强大的集成开发环境,为我们提供了利用正则表达式进行批量替换字符串的便捷功能,这能够大大提高开发效率。
打开需要进行操作的文件或项目。在 IntelliJ IDEA 中,可以通过快捷键 Ctrl + Shift + R 调出“Replace in Path”(在路径中替换)的对话框。
接下来,在“Find”(查找)输入框中输入要查找的正则表达式。正则表达式是一种强大的模式匹配工具,它允许我们以灵活的方式定义要查找的字符串模式。例如,如果要查找所有以“abc”开头的字符串,可以输入“^abc”。
在“Replace with”(替换为)输入框中输入要替换成的字符串。这里可以是一个简单的字符串,也可以包含一些特殊的转义字符和变量。
然后,需要注意选择替换的范围。可以是整个项目、当前模块、指定的文件夹或者特定的文件类型等。根据实际需求进行准确的选择,以确保只对需要修改的部分进行操作。
在进行批量替换之前,强烈建议先点击“Preview”(预览)按钮。这会显示所有符合查找条件的字符串以及将要进行的替换结果。通过预览,可以检查替换是否符合预期,避免出现意外的错误修改。
如果预览结果没有问题,就可以点击“Replace”(替换)按钮进行实际的批量替换操作。
另外,正则表达式的语法可能会比较复杂,需要一定的学习和实践才能熟练掌握。一些常见的正则表达式符号和用法,如“.”表示任意字符、“*”表示零个或多个前一个字符、“+”表示一个或多个前一个字符等,都需要了解清楚。
在 IntelliJ IDEA 中利用正则表达式批量替换字符串是一项非常实用的技能。通过合理地运用正则表达式和准确设置替换选项,可以快速、高效地完成对代码或文本的修改工作,节省大量的时间和精力,让开发工作更加流畅和高效。
- 解决MySQL数据库导入中文乱码问题的方案
- MySQL 搜索引擎及其差异
- SQL优化:轻松提升SQL性能的文章
- 深度剖析MySQL主从配置源码与复制原理
- MySQL子查询:概念与实际使用示例
- MySQL数据库分库分表技术难点应对策略
- MySQL 数据库导出与导入 SQL 数据库文件的命令
- Hibernate 配置文件的工作原理及一对多、多对多两种设计方式
- MySQL 高可用运维:基于 MySQL 数据库展开探讨
- Mysql开发常见陷阱:Mysql无法启动
- 收藏!Mac OS S 安装 DMG 文件版 MySQL 后报错的解决办法
- 超简单!一步教你用mysql实现日期时间查询
- 纯 Python 实现的 MySQL 客户端操作库分享
- MySQL 中 concat 与 group_concat 的使用方法简介
- MySQL大数据查询性能优化全解(附图)